General functions

Access codes

You can use the access codes described in this section to
avoid unauthorized use of your phone. The access codes
(except PUK and PUK2 codes) can be changed by using (Menu
9.4.5).
PIN code (4 to 8 digits)
The PIN (Personal Identification Number) code protects your
SIM card against unauthorized use. The PIN code is usually
supplied with the SIM card. When PIN code is set On, your
phone will request the PIN code every time it is switched on.
On the contrary, when PIN code is set Off, your phone
connects to the network directly without the request PIN code.
PIN2 code (4 to 8 digits)
The PIN2 code, supplied with some SIM cards, is required to
access some functions such as Advice of call charge, Fixed
Dial number. These functions are only available if supported by
your SIM card.

PUK code (4 to 8 digits)
The PUK (PIN Unblocking Key) code is required to change a
blocked PIN code. The PUK code may be supplied with the SIM
card. If not, contact your local service provider for the code. If
you lose the code, also contact your service provider.
PUK2 code (4 to 8 digits)
The PUK2 code, supplied with some SIM cards, is required to
change a blocked PIN2 code. If you lose the code, also contact
your service provider.
Security code (4 to 8 digits)
The security code protects the unauthorized use of your phone.
It is usually supplied with the phone. This code is required to
delete all phone entries and to activate "Reset settings" menu.
The default number is "0000".
